Welcome to our Memories of the Frontier Auction. This three day Auction has over 3000 lots to choose from.

Day 3: High End Western Art Collection, Western and Historical Photography, Ruana Knifes, Military Collectibles, Civil War Relics, Firearms, Taxidermy, GI Joe and Transformers Toys, Fishing Lures/Rods/Reels, Swords/Knives/Daggers, and so much more.

Artists include: John Ford Clymer, Joseph Henry Sharp, John Fery, Edgar Sheriff Paxson, Birger Sandzen, Clyde Aspevig, Alexandra Athanassiades, William Standing, Olaf Carl Seltzer, Tom Browning, Robert LaDuke, William Henry Jackson and many more.

Native American Art and Artifacts, Artwork, Jewelry, Mining and Fishing Collectibles, Coins, Pocket Watches, Father Anthony Ravalli Painting, Bronzes, Books, Photographs, Instruments, Taxidermy and more.
